The Boston Modern Orchestra Project (BMOP) is in residence at Wellesley College for the 2010-2011 academic year. BMOP is dedicated to commissioning, performing, and recording new orchestral music. Throughout the year, musicians of this premier orchestra will interact with music department student performers, composers, and music historians, teaching master classes, coaching ensembles, and visiting classrooms. They will offer the College and the wider community three free public performances.
Pre-concert talk with composer Martin Brody / 7:00 PM
Music by Wayne Peterson, Milton Babbitt, and the world premiere of Touching Bottom by Wellesley College faculty member Martin Brody.
